Abstract


An integrated fish culture experiment with poultry was carried out at fresh Water Biological Research Station, Bhavanisagar during 1986-87. Poultry droppings were added in the experimental pond at the rate of 8 t/ha/ycar instead of supplementary feeding and manuring. The fish species Viz., Catla, Rohu, Mrigal and Common carp in the ratio of 3:2:2:3 were stocked at the rate of ten thousand numbers per hectare. A total production of 4125 kg of fish/ha/year was recorded in the experimental pond against 3500 kg in control pond. The increase in yield being 18 per cent over control. The production cost per kg of fish was reduced from Rs. 5.75 in the control to 2.00 in experimental pond. In addition, the fertility status of the experimental pond was also improved.
